WinUpGo
Іздеу
CASWINO
SKYSLOTS
BRAMA
TETHERPAY
777 FREE SPINS + 300%
Cryptocurrency казино Крипто казино Torrent Gear - сіздің әмбебап торрент іздеу! Torrent Gear

Казино bridge арқылы live-провайдерлерді қалай қосады

Live-казино контекстінде bridge дегеніміз не?

Bridge - оператор платформасы мен live-провайдерлер (Evolution, Pragmatic Live, Ezugi, TVBet және т.б.) арасындағы қабат, ол API, оқиғаларды, логиканы және қаржылық есептерді қалыпқа келтіреді. Қарапайым сөзбен айтқанда, bridge ондаған түрлі интеграцияларды бірдей етеді: бірыңғай мөлшерлеме келісімшарты, бірыңғай раунд мәртебесі, біркелкі webhooks және есептілік.

Ол не үшін қажет

Ондаған провайдерлерге арналған бірыңғай келісімшарт (платформадағы өзгерістер аз).

Теңсіздік және қосарланудан қорғау (желілік ретрациялар, ойыншының reconnect).

Каталогты қалыпқа келтіру (кестелер, лимиттер, side-bets, локальдар).

Бірыңғай касса және тәуекел-ережелер (лимиттер, AML/KYT, RG).

Провайдерлер бойынша QoS ағыны мен SLA мониторингі.


Компоненттер тізбегі

1. Casino Platform (хост): аккаунттар, KYC/RG, бонустар, әмиян, фронт.

2. Bridge: провайдерлер адаптерлері, оқиғалар bus, үстелдер/лимиттер маппингі, қаржылық есептеулер, логистер, webhooks.

3. Live-Provider: стрим (әдетте WebRTC/HLS), ойын қозғалтқышы, шығыстарды есептеу, дилерлер.

4. Әмиян: Seamless (теңгерім операторда сақталады) немесе Transfer (ойын банкіне провайдерде депозит).

5. Бақылау қабілеті: ағын метрикасы (FPS, RTT, буфер), бизнес-метрика (Bet, GGR, Hold).


Желілік хаттамалар мен сессиялар

Бейне:
  • WebRTC - төмен кідіріс (100-500 мс), ICE/STUN/TURN талап етіледі.
  • HLS/LL-HLS - жоғары кідіріс, бірақ CDN оңай.
  • Тарифтер мен оқиғалар: WebSocket/HTTP-SSE/REST.
  • Токендер: қысқа өмір сүретін JWT/opaque (TTL 3-10 мин), провайдердің талабы бойынша ротация.

Әмиян үлгілері

1) Seamless wallet (ұсынылады)

Мөлшерлеме/төлем bridge арқылы оператордың әмиянына өтеді.

Артықшылықтары: бірыңғай баланс, лимиттерді жедел бақылау, жеңілдетілген RG.

Минустар: әмиянның қолжетімділігіне қатаң талаптар (SLA).

2) Transfer wallet

Ойыншы қаражатты провайдердің «үстел банкіне» аударады.

Артықшылықтары: шыңдалған кезде оператордың әмиянына аз жүктеме.

Кемшіліктері: қайтару күрделірек, reconcile және AML-бақылау, UX үйкеліс.


Сессияның тіршілік циклі (seamless)

1 ./createSession → bridge 'sessionId' жасайды, 'streamUrl', 'betSocketUrl' қайтарады.

2. Фронт ойнатқышты (WebRTC/HLS) және оқиғалар қосылымын ашады.

3. Ойыншы → 'placeBet' -ті bridge ('idempotencyKey', 'roundId', 'selection', 'stake') деп қояды.

4. Bridge әмияндағы соманы (hold) алдын ала авторизациялайды → провайдерді растайды.

5. Провайдер 'bettingClosed' → spin/deal → 'roundResult' деп хабарлайды.

6. Bridge төлемдерді есептейді, hold есептен шығарады/қайтарады, 'transactionId' жасайды.

7. Bridge webhook платформасына жібереді ('roundId', 'result', 'payout', 'balanceAfter'), деп жазады леджерге.

8. Аяқтау/қайта қосу - 'sessionId' (теңдессіз).


Оқиғалар келісімшарты (мысал)

Мөлшерлеме → bridge (WS/REST):
json
{
"type": "bet. place",  "idempotencyKey": "c0a4-77f…",  "sessionId": "sess_abc123",  "roundId": "R-2025-10-17-18:45:03-Table23",  "selection": [{"market":"roulette_straight","value":"17"}],  "stake": {"amount":"5. 00","currency":"EUR"},  "limitsProfile":"VIP_A"
}
bridge жауабы:
json
{
"status":"accepted",  "balanceHold":"-5. 00",  "betId":"bet_9f2…",  "effectiveLimits":{"maxBet":"5000. 00"}
}
Раундтың нәтижесі → платформа (webhook):
json
{
"event":"round. settle",  "roundId":"R-2025-10-17-18:45:03-Table23",  "bets":[
{"betId":"bet_9f2…","stake":"5. 00","payout":"180. 00","outcome":"WIN"}
],  "transactions":[
{"id":"trn_bet_9f2…","type":"DEBIT","amount":"5. 00"},   {"id":"trn_pay_9f2…","type":"CREDIT","amount":"180. 00"}
],  "balanceAfter":"1320. 40"
}
Негізгі ережелер:
  • Сәйкестік: 'idempotencyKey' деген барлық сұраулар.
  • Нәтижелердің нақты түрі: 'WIN/LOSE/PUSH/VOID/RETRY'.
  • Тұрақты идентификаторлар: 'roundId' жаһандық бірегей (кесте + уақыт + шард).

Каталог және лимиттер

Discovery: '/providers/: id/tables '- үстелдер тізімі, лимиттер, side-bets, тілдер, кесте.

Лимит пулдары: «DEFAULT», «VIP _ A», «VIP _ B», «Ultra».

Маппинг ережелері: ел/валюта/KYC мәртебесі → рұқсат етілетін үстелдер мен лимит профильдері.

Лимиттердің ыстық ауысуы: оқиғалар 'limits. update 'үстелін қайта жүктемей.


Ағынның бақылануы және сапасы (QoS)

Ойыншы бойынша өлшемдері:
  • RTT ставка сигналдары (мақсаты <150 мс WebRTC).
  • Dropped frames / buffer events.
  • Bitrate/Resolution бейімделуі.
  • Bet window latency ('bettingOpen' және нақты мөлшерлемені қабылдау арасындағы уақыт).
Провайдер/үстел бойынша өлшемдер:
  • Үстелдің аптайымы, aborted rounds, late settlements, жиілігі 'VOID'.
  • Ставкалар жабылғаннан кейінгі орташа time-to-settle.
  • QoS алерты: FPS деградациясы, 'retry' жарқылдауы.

Комплаенс және қауіпсіздік

KYT/AML: депозит көздерін талдау, «жоғары тәуекел» жалауы → live ставкаларына тыйым салу.

RG (жауапты ойын): тайм-ауттар, лимиттер, өзін-өзі жою - 'placeBet' дейін қолданылады.

Data residency: логика және PII операторда сақталады; bridge тек техникалық сақтайды. журналдар мен агрегаттар.

Transport security: mTLS/IP-whitelist провайдерлерге, HMAC сұрауларының қолтаңбасы, қысқа TTL токендері.

Аудит: өзгермейтін леджер (WORM/append-only), 'roundId '/' sessionId' бойынша экспорт.


Есептеу, reconcile және қайтарулар

On-the-fly settle: әрбір нәтиже бойынша дереу дебет/кредит.

Batch reconcile: провайдердің есептерін (hourly/daily) bridge леджерімен (P&L, комиссионка) салыстыру.

VOID/REFUND сценарийлері: ағын ақауы, дилер қатесі, дау - нақты себептердің кодтары бар ішінара/толық қайтару.

Dispute-орталық: Қолдау тикеттерді тез шешуі үшін 'roundId' байланысы бейнефид жазбасы (тайм-код).


Өнімділік және істен шығу тұрақтылығы

Скалировка: провайдерлердің stateless-адаптерлері + Kafka/NATS оқиға шинасы ретінде.

Сақтау орны: сессияларға арналған ыстық (Redis), леджерлерге арналған жылы (Postgres), логтарға арналған суық (S3).

Фолбэктер: егер әмиян жауап бермесе - 'SOFT _ DECLINE' ретраларымен; егер провайдер қол жеткізгісіз болса - үстелдерді өшіру/лоббилерде жасыру.

Теңсіздік ретрайлері: желілік таймауттар бойынша 'placeBet '/' settle' қайталау қауіпсіз.


UX: Фронтенд үлгілері

Сағат қадамдастыру: 'serverTime' пайдаланыңыз 'Арқылы ставкаларды жабу'...

Локализация: дилердің тілі ≠ интерфейс тілі; терминдердің субтитрлерін/глоссарийін көрсетіңіз.

Стрим-плеер: auto-fallback WebRTC → LL-HLS нашар желіде.

Error UI: түсінікті кодтар ('LBRG-401 TOKEN_EXPIRED',' LBRG-429 LIMIT_EXCEEDED', 'LBRG-503 PROVIDER_DOWN').

Көптабличтілік: сессияны үзбей үстелдерді жылдам толтыру (reuse 'sessionId').


Қарсы үлгілер

Ұзақ өмір сүретін токендерді клиентке сақтау.

Дилеядан кейін 'bettingClosed' ставкасын қабылдау - дауға кепілдік берілген.

Ретраяларда 'idempotencyKey' → дублінің болмауы.

'roundId' және есептерде time-zones араластыру.

Профильсіз және KYC-мәртебесіз «көзге» лимиттер қою.

QoS ағынын елемеу - ұялы желілерде жоғары churn.


Қадамдық енгізу жоспары (чек-парақ)

Сәулет және келісімшарттар

  • Оқиғаның бірыңғай келісімшартын орнату: 'bet. place`, `bet. accepted`, `bet. rejected`, `round. settle`, `limits. update`, `session. close`, `provider. error`.
  • idempotency және 'roundId', 'betId', 'transactionId' пішімдерін анықтау.
  • Әмиян моделін таңдау (Seamless басым).

Қауіпсіздік

  • Провайдерлерге mTLS, HMAC-қолтаңба webhooks, TTL токені ≤ 10 минут.
  • RG/AML/KYT ставкаларға рұқсат беруге дейінгі саясаты, аудит-журнал.

Каталог және лимиттер

  • Үстелдер мен лимиттер бейіндерінің импорты, елдер/валюталар/АКҚ бойынша маппинг.
  • Үстелдердің лимиттері мен мәртебелерін ыстық жаңарту.

Фронтенд

  • LL-HLS фолбэкті WebRTC ойнатқышы, синхрондау сағаттары, тұрақты мөлшерлеме таймерлері.
  • Error кодтары және адам оқитын хабарлар.

Тест-жоспар

  • High-latency/packet-loss сценарийлер, мөлшерлемені жоғалтпай reconnection.
  • Ставканы қос басу → бір дебет (іспеттілік).
  • VOID/REFUND, даулы раундтар, есеп айырмашылықтары.

Бақылау мүмкіндігі

  • Дашборд QoS: RTT, dropped frames, aborted rounds, time-to-settle.
  • Провайдердің SLA бойынша тәуекелдері, reconcile есептері.

Bridge «хайуанаттар паркін» басқарылатын жүйеге айналдырады: бірыңғай мөлшерлемелер, бірыңғай есептеулер, болжамды UX және ағын сапасын ашық бақылау. Дұрыс жобаланған bridge операторы жаңа live-провайдерлерді жылдам қосады, технологиялық тәуекелдерді азайтады және P & L-ді демпотенттік, қатаң лимиттер және нақты бақылау есебінен қорғайды.

× Ойын бойынша іздеу
Іздеуді бастау үшін кемінде 3 таңба енгізіңіз.